convergent |
tending to move toward a common point or intersection. |
enigmatic |
puzzling, mysterious, or inexplicable. |
equestrian |
of or relating to horseback riding. |
escalation |
increase in amount, scope, or intensity. |
eulogize |
to speak or write high praise of, or make a formal tribute to (usually a dead person). |
filch |
to steal (usually something of slight value) in a sly manner; pilfer. |
impenetrable |
impossible to enter; impervious. |
ingratiate |
to seek or secure another's favor or approval for (oneself). |
pirouette |
a ballet movement involving a rapid rotation of the body upon the toes or foot. |
portal |
a doorway or entrance, especially a large and imposing one. |
preposterous |
totally unlikely, unbelievable, or senseless; absurd. |
recession1 |
a period of reduced or declining economic activity. |
satiate |
to glut or fill to excess; oversupply; surfeit. |
stymie |
throw an obstacle in the way of (something or someone); impede; thwart. |
tangential |
barely connected to or touching a subject. |
